Stoneridge Expands MirrorEye Fleet Evaluations

MirrorEye replaces a truck’s mirrors with integrated external digital cameras and digital monitors inside the cab of the truck to provide the driver with enhanced vision in most operating environments where it is difficult to see with traditional mirrors.

FMCSA to Study 'Excessive Commuting' by Truck Drivers

The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ration is seeking comment on a proposed survey of “excessive commuting” by truck drivers. The agency is defining as excessive any commuting to work that exceeds 150 minutes.
